    ROM flashing issues

    I've been having issues with flashing certain roms. I know the drill, bootstrap recovery, wipe data cache and dalvik, flash rom reboot. The problem is that the only roms that will flash successfully are the gb leak, apex and liberty. Not that those are not great roms, I just can't keep a rom too long lol. With my d1 I would rotate through about 5 roms a week. With cm7 or ss4d2 or zombiestomp I get a bootloop at the M and end up having to sbf back to froyo and reroot and reflash the leak...a real pain in the butt.     Which versions of Liberty and Apex are you having success with? If its liberty GB and Apex 2.0 rc2 or rc3, then that makes sense. They are GB based ROMs so if you flash the leak first and then them you will be OK. But if you flash the leak and then try to flash CM7 that you got from ROM Manager or SSD2 like you mentioned you will bootloop, they require the same kernel as froyo and will not flash if you are on the GB leak. There is a GB based version of CM7 but they are unofficial so you can not get them from ROM Manager yet.

    No worries I made the switch not that long ago too. Quite a learning curve coming from the D1 where you could flash anything on it and if you messed up it was almost too easy to fix.

    You are correct in assuming that if you want to flash SSD2 or CM7 official nightlies then you would need to SBF back to froyo first. If you would like, before you do that, as I mentioned there is a version of CM7 that you can flash from where you are now. Just go into the CM section here and look for the thread.
